Ultimate Guide to Lithium-Ion Battery Fire Safety

The rise of lithium-ion batteries in our daily lives is nothing short of remarkable. From smartphones to electric vehicles, these powerhouses fuel the technology that drives our world. However, with great power comes great responsibility. The increasing number of lithium-ion battery incidents has shed light on the importance of fire safety regarding these prevalent energy sources. This comprehensive guide will explore lithium-ion battery fire safety, including prevention, detection, and response strategies.

Understanding Lithium-Ion Batteries

Lithium-ion batteries are rechargeable energy storage devices widely used due to their high energy density and lightweight characteristics. They function by moving lithium ions from the anode to the cathode during discharge and back when charging. While they are designed for safety and longevity, improper handling, faulty manufacturing, or mechanical damage can lead to overheating, fires, or even explosions.

Why Are Lithium-Ion Batteries Dangerous?

Although lithium-ion batteries are generally safe when handled correctly, they can become dangerous under specific conditions:

  • Overcharging: Continuous charging beyond the battery's capacity can lead to thermal runaway, resulting in fires.
  • Deep Discharge: Allowing batteries to discharge completely can cause internal damage and make them susceptible to fires when recharged.
  • Physical Damage: Dropping or puncturing a battery can create short circuits, resulting in overheating.
  • Manufacturing Defects: Poor quality control can lead to faulty batteries that are more prone to failure.

Preventing Lithium-Ion Battery Fires

Taking precautions can significantly reduce the risk of lithium-ion battery fires. Here are some essential safety tips:

1. Use Approved Chargers

Always use chargers that come with your device or are certified by the manufacturer. Using third-party or incompatible chargers can lead to overcharging and overheating.

2. Avoid Extreme Temperatures

Never expose lithium-ion batteries to extreme temperatures, either hot or cold. High temperatures can cause the battery to swell and fail, while extreme cold can affect its performance.

3. Store Properly

When not in use, store your batteries in a cool and dry place. Keep them away from flammable materials to minimize risks if a fire does occur.

4. Inspect Regularly

Regularly inspect your batteries for signs of damage or wear, such as bulging, cracks, or corrosion. If you notice any of these signs, cease using the battery immediately.

5. Never Leave Unattended

Avoid leaving devices that contain lithium-ion batteries unattended while charging. Monitoring the charging process reduces the risk of fires going unnoticed.

Detecting Lithium-Ion Battery Failures

Detecting early signs of battery failure can prevent dangerous situations:

1. Physical Observation

Look for signs such as swelling, leaking, or unusual odors. Any visible deformities should be treated seriously.

2. Excessive Heat

Feeling heat radiating from a device is a red flag. If your device feels hot to the touch, stop using it immediately.

3. Unusual Sounds

Listen for hissing or popping sounds during charging or use, which may suggest internal damage.

What to Do in Case of a Fire

If a lithium-ion battery fire occurs, it's crucial to act quickly and appropriately:

1. Evacuate the Area

The first priority should be something simple: get away from the fire. Ensure everyone is a safe distance from the source.

2. Call Emergency Services

If the fire spreads, call your local emergency services immediately.

3. Use Appropriate Fire Extinguishers

In some cases, having a Class D fire extinguisher on hand can help. These extinguishers are designed for metal fires, including those involving lithium. However, it's always best to defer to professionals.

4. Stay Calm

Panic can reignite dangerous situations. Remain calm and focused on ensuring safety first.

Proper Disposal of Lithium-Ion Batteries

Disposing of lithium-ion batteries correctly is essential for environmental safety and fire prevention:

1. Recycling Programs

Investigate local recycling programs specifically designed for battery disposal. Many retailers and municipalities offer safe disposal methods.

2. Transport Safely

If transporting batteries for disposal, ensure they are in secure packaging to prevent damage during transit.

3. Never Throw Them in the Trash

Dumping lithium-ion batteries in regular trash can lead to severe environmental hazards and fire risks in landfills. Always seek proper disposal avenues.
